Average Amusement and Recreation Attendants Salary in Albany-Schenectady-Troy, NY

Amusement and Recreation Attendants in the Albany-Schenectady-Troy, NY area earn an average annual salary of $34,780. This figure is notably higher than the national average of $31,160, suggesting that local economic factors and demand within this specific region contribute to a more favorable compensation structure for these roles. The cost of living in Albany also aligns with the national average, making this salary potentially more impactful.

Albany-Schenectady-Troy, NY has 0.77x the national average concentration of Amusement and Recreation Attendants jobs. This means there are fewer opportunities per capita here compared to the U.S. average — competition for roles may be higher.

Methodology: Salary data is derived from the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) OEWS 2024 release. Figures represent gross pay before taxes. Analysis includes 820 employees in the Albany-Schenectady-Troy, NY area with a job density of 1.844 per 1,000 jobs. Cost of Living data is estimated based on state and metro averages.
